During midlife, many women begin to experience symptoms related to menopause such as mood swings, sleep problems, and hot flashes. These symptoms can be bothersome and interfere with the quality of life.
Women with HIV may already experience depressed mood, sleep problems, and hot flashes/night sweats related to HIV or social/medical conditions before entering menopause. For this reason, it is hard to know if these symptoms are related to menopause or HIV. It is also unclear if HIV is affecting menopause symptoms or if menopause is affecting HIV symptoms. This uncertainty may be upsetting to women with HIV at midlife.
